数学计算库LIB:libgsl.lib使用详解
版权申诉
5星 · 超过95%的资源 105 浏览量
更新于2024-11-23
收藏 169KB RAR 举报
资源摘要信息:"一个名为‘数学库LIB_libgsl.lib_源码’的文件,其描述为‘一个数学计算的LIB库,使用方便,实用的地方很多’。该文件的标签为‘libgsl.lib’,是压缩包子文件的一部分,文件名称列表为‘数学库LIB’。"
从给定的文件信息中,我们可以提取出以下知识点:
1. 文件类型和用途:文件标题“数学库LIB_libgsl.lib_源码”暗示这是一款数学计算库的源代码文件,文件以LIB为扩展名,表明它可能是一个编译后的库文件,通常用于在程序中调用其中定义的函数,以实现特定的数学计算功能。"libgsl.lib"作为标签,很可能是指GNU Scientific Library的简写,这是一个广泛使用的开源数学库。
2. GNU Scientific Library (GSL):GSL是一个C语言编写的支持数值计算的库,提供了大量的数学计算功能,如线性代数、快速傅里叶变换、随机数生成、多项式运算等。它不仅包含了大量的数学算法实现,还提供了很好的数值计算精度,是许多科学计算软件的重要组成部分。
3. 库文件的使用:通常情况下,库文件分为静态库和动态库(共享库)两种类型。静态库在程序编译时会被全部链接到可执行文件中,而动态库则在程序运行时被加载。"libgsl.lib"可能是一个静态库文件,开发者在编译自己的程序时,可以将这个库链接进去,从而方便地使用GSL提供的数学计算功能。
4. 压缩包子文件:这可能是一个包含了多个文件的压缩文件,文件名称列表中只给出了“数学库LIB”,这表明压缩包里可能包含与数学库相关的多种文件类型,例如源代码文件、头文件、文档说明等。压缩文件的使用非常广泛,它可以有效地减小文件体积,便于传输和存储。
5. 实用性:标题中的描述“实用的地方很多”可能指的是该数学库适用范围广,不仅可用于科学研究,还能服务于工程设计、数据分析、教育等多个领域。数学计算是许多领域不可或缺的组成部分,因此一个功能强大的数学库能够在多个层面上提供支持。
6. 源码的重要性:源码文件通常包含了库的实现细节,对于开发者来说,可以阅读和理解源码,从而更好地使用库中的功能,同时也有助于故障排查和性能优化。对于开源库而言,源码还是进行定制开发和贡献改进的基础。
综合以上知识点,可以认为“数学库LIB_libgsl.lib_源码”是一个宝贵的资源,对需要进行数学计算的开发者来说,它不仅提供了丰富的数学功能,还可能包含了源代码,有助于深入理解和扩展其功能。同时,该资源也体现了开源软件在IT行业中的重要作用,尤其是在科学计算这一专业领域。
236 浏览量
2012-10-06 上传
2009-04-09 上传
2024-06-21 上传
2017-10-18 上传
2009-10-14 上传
2016-02-04 上传
2024-11-27 上传
2024-11-27 上传
2024-11-27 上传
浊池
- 粉丝: 53
- 资源: 4780
最新资源
- MATLAB新功能:Multi-frame ViewRGB制作彩色图阴影
- XKCD Substitutions 3-crx插件:创新的网页文字替换工具
- Python实现8位等离子效果开源项目plasma.py解读
- 维护商店移动应用:基于PhoneGap的移动API应用
- Laravel-Admin的Redis Manager扩展使用教程
- Jekyll代理主题使用指南及文件结构解析
- cPanel中PHP多版本插件的安装与配置指南
- 深入探讨React和Typescript在Alias kopio游戏中的应用
- node.js OSC服务器实现:Gibber消息转换技术解析
- 体验最新升级版的mdbootstrap pro 6.1.0组件库
- 超市盘点过机系统实现与delphi应用
- Boogle: 探索 Python 编程的 Boggle 仿制品
- C++实现的Physics2D简易2D物理模拟
- 傅里叶级数在分数阶微分积分计算中的应用与实现
- Windows Phone与PhoneGap应用隔离存储文件访问方法
- iso8601-interval-recurrence:掌握ISO8601日期范围与重复间隔检查